Abstract

Complementary and alternative medicine approaches are widely used by breast cancer patients. We present a case series of four patients with breast cancer who underwent a pragmatic integrative medicine protocol in an inpatient integrative oncology setting. The participants were three metastatic and one non-metastatic breast cancer patient who did not undergo any standard cancer therapies. The holistic integrative medicine protocol includes counselling, oncothermia, high-dose vitamin C therapy, ozone therapy, diet therapy, liposomal curcumin therapy, vitamin D supplementation, artesunate injections, probiotic supplementation, Co-Q enzyme therapy, hyperbaric ozone therapy, medical cannabis, coffee enema, colour therapy, sun exposure, and yoga therapy. The treatment duration varied from person to person. All the patients have shown significant improvement in their complete blood cell counts, reduction in their cancer markers. The thermal scan has shown a complete arrest of disease activity in the breast compared to baseline. Further, all the patients have shown improvement in their body weight and expressed a complete revival of subjective wellbeing. The holistic integrative medicine protocol looks promising in the management of breast cancer. However, large-scale randomized control trials are warranted to validate the present findings.
